Heremos

Heremos (died 431 BC) was an Athenian messenger who was employed by Cleon during the Peloponnesian War. In 431 BC, Cleon tasked Heremos with delivering supplies to rebels in Mytilene, but Heremos was captured by Spartan soldiers as he attempted to head for his ship off the coast of Attica. He was taken to the Mt. Pentelikos Marble Quarry, where he was tortured into giving up the Athenian plan and then hanged. Kassandra, a mercenary hired by Cleon to rescue Heremos, found his body, but she succeeded in rescuing his companion Onomakles and completing the mission.
